Which Form Locator would you use to record the Source of Admission?

Explanation:
The data element that records where the patient came from at the start of the hospital stay is captured in the Form Locator designated for Source of Admission. On the UB-04, that field is located in Form Locator 15. It indicates the admission source—whether the patient was admitted from another facility, from home, from a clinic, etc.—and is used by payers and agencies to track admission patterns. The other form locators are used for different data items (for example, separate locators cover the type of admission or other admission details), so they wouldn’t be the correct place to record the Source of Admission.
